Slot Number
12668093
Finalized
Epoch Number
Status
proposed
Age
140 days 19 hrs ago (Sep-25-2025 10:58:59 PM +UTC)

BlockRoot Hash
0xcde2b950bcdae76352ddcc63c2ba3ac94e97dac385c93e23785428f43d8ad37b
State Root
0xf0b7ca398758c4ced6729bad3939536fefa474fc0f3c9af023872121ef890923

Randao Reveal
0x984564e51cad7739604180bd40709d25d054f5e1f9dd710630abcd0f8e31c52f47be450d8a71525dad4467f9c628d15f0a8d5b99b0dc883db7a6c19e9ff97b990a63c7a890c8780720976069123e9733a6202b503382583da80529ec69260212

Graffiti
(Hex:0x457665727374616b65202f20506f6f6c00000000000000000000000000000000)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0x85e26e969fed2a4500650f14299742fc1d87d0e866f1ea901f07f2f6f9cb04951a37dda09653f604e2e6e648561cdbb5165e9691d2ebea4f2863224a993f0ff9f7838d695376842b6197f545eea40307109c00f502ab8fe616d9fc587662ac9e

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ators